Here's our top SUBU mental health tips

  • Tune in to your bodyShort, regular breaks can help you avoid burnout. When you start feeling tired or overwhelmed, it’s a signal to pause. 

  • Keep in touch - A brief conversation with a friend, course mate, or staff member can lift your spirits more than you’d think.

  • Move in ways that feel goodGentle activities like stretching, walking, or yoga can ease stress and sharpen your concentration.

  • Practice self loveAllowing yourself to rest is important and valid.

  • Reach out when things feel heavyAsking for help is a sign of courage, and there are plenty of support services like SUBU Advice ready to listen.
